VMware群晖:解决硬盘速度慢的策略
vmware群晖硬盘速度慢

首页 2025-03-14 23:46:37



解决VMware中群晖硬盘速度慢的问题:深度剖析与优化策略 在虚拟化技术日益普及的今天,VMware作为业界领先的虚拟化平台,被广泛应用于企业数据中心

    而群晖(Synology)作为知名的网络附加存储(NAS)品牌,以其强大的功能性和易用性,成为了许多企业和个人用户的首选存储解决方案

    然而,在实际应用中,不少用户发现,在VMware环境中运行的群晖设备,其硬盘读写速度往往不尽如人意,这极大地影响了业务效率和用户体验

    本文将深入探讨这一问题的根源,并提出有效的优化策略,以期帮助用户解决VMware中群晖硬盘速度慢的挑战

     一、问题分析:VMware与群晖硬盘速度的瓶颈所在 1.虚拟化层开销 虚拟化技术虽然带来了资源的高效利用和灵活部署,但同时也引入了额外的虚拟化层开销

    VMware ESXi作为虚拟化平台,需要管理虚拟机的资源分配、内存管理、I/O调度等,这些操作都会增加系统开销,从而影响存储I/O性能

    尤其是在高负载或复杂存储场景下,虚拟化层的开销可能成为性能瓶颈

     2.存储I/O路径复杂 在VMware环境中,群晖NAS的存储访问需要通过虚拟机、虚拟化层、物理网络以及NAS自身的存储系统等多个层次

    这一复杂的I/O路径不仅增加了延迟,还可能因为网络拥堵、配置不当或硬件限制等因素,导致存储性能下降

     3.硬盘类型与配置 硬盘类型(如HDD与SSD)和配置方式(RAID级别、缓存策略等)直接影响存储性能

    在虚拟化环境中,如果群晖NAS使用的是传统HDD或低性能的RAID配置,其读写速度自然会受到限制

    此外,虚拟机硬盘文件(VMDK)的格式和存储策略也会影响I/O性能

     4.网络带宽与延迟 虚拟化环境中的存储访问依赖于物理网络,网络带宽不足或延迟过高都会直接影响存储性能

    尤其是在大规模数据传输或高并发访问时,网络瓶颈问题尤为突出

     5.群晖NAS配置与优化 群晖NAS本身的配置与优化程度也是影响存储性能的关键因素

    包括DSM版本、存储卷配置、文件系统类型、网络设置以及是否启用了数据去重、压缩等高级功能,都会对存储性能产生影响

     二、优化策略:提升VMware中群晖硬盘速度的有效方法 1.优化虚拟化层配置 - 资源分配:确保为运行群晖NAS的虚拟机分配足够的CPU和内存资源,避免资源争用导致的性能下降

     - I/O调度策略:在VMware ESXi中,可以调整I/O调度策略,如使用“I/O延迟敏感性”高的虚拟机配置,以优化存储I/O性能

     - 存储策略:根据业务需求选择合适的虚拟机硬盘格式(如厚置备延迟置零、厚置备立即置零)和存储策略,以平衡性能和空间利用率

     2.简化存储I/O路径 - 直接路径I/O(DirectPath I/O):启用此功能可以减少虚拟化层的I/O处理开销,提高存储性能

    但需注意,这可能需要特定的硬件支持和配置

     - 使用VMware vSAN:如果条件允许,可以考虑使用VMware vSAN作为虚拟化存储解决方案,它提供了高性能的分布式存储,有助于提升存储I/O性能

     - 网络优化:确保物理网络连接稳定且带宽充足,避免网络拥堵

    同时,可以考虑使用10GbE或更高速度的网络接口卡

     3.升级硬盘与配置 - 采用SSD:相比HDD,SSD具有更高的读写速度和更低的延迟,是提升存储性能的有效手段

     - 优化RAID配置:根据数据重要性和性能需求选择合适的RAID级别

    例如,RAID 10提供了良好的性能和数据保护能力

     - 启用缓存:在群晖NAS中启用读写缓存可以显著提高存储性能

    但需注意缓存的大小和类型(DRAM或SSD)对性能的影响

     4.网络带宽与延迟优化 - 流量控制:使用QoS(服务质量)策略控制网络流量,确保关键业务获得足够的带宽

     - 减少网络跳数:简化网络拓扑结构,减少数据包在网络中的传输跳数,降低延迟

     - 负载均衡:在多网卡环境中实施负载均衡,避免单一网卡成为性能瓶颈

     5.群晖NAS深度优化 - 升级DSM版本:确保群晖NAS运行的是最新版本的DSM操作系统,以获得最新的性能优化和安全性更新

     - 存储卷与文件系统优化:根据业务需求选择合适的存储卷类型和文件系统(如Btrfs或EXT4),并进行必要的调优

     - 禁用不必要的服务:关闭群晖NAS上不必要的服务或功能,如数据去重、压缩等,以减少系统开销

     - 定期维护:定期对群晖NAS进行磁盘检查、碎片整理等维护工作,保持存储系统的健康状态

     三、案例分析:实战中的性能提升 以某企业为例,该企业在VMware环境中部署了群晖NAS作为文件服务器,但发现存储性能无法满足业务需求

    经过深入分析,发现虚拟化层开销、存储I/O路径复杂以及硬盘类型配置不当是导致性能瓶颈的主要原因

    针对这些问题,该企业采取了以下优化措施: - 为虚拟机分配了更多的CPU和内存资源,并启用了DirectPath I/O功能

     - 将群晖NAS的硬盘从HDD升级为SSD,并优化了RAID配置为RAID 10

     - 升级了物理网络接口卡至10GbE,并对网络进行了流量控制和负载均衡配置

     - 在群晖NAS中启用了读写缓存,并关闭了不必要的数据去重和压缩功能

     经过上述优化,该企业的群晖NAS在VMware环境中的存储性能得到了显著提升,读写速度提高了近50%,有效满足了业务需求

     四、结论与展望 VMware环境中群晖硬盘速度慢的问题,是一个涉及虚拟化层、存储I/O路径、硬盘配置、网络带宽以及群晖NAS自身优化等多个方面的复杂问题

    通过深入分析并采取针对性的优化策略,我们可以有效提升存储性能,满足业务需求

    未来,随着虚拟化技术、存储技术以及网络技术的不断发展,我们有理由相信,VMware环境中的群晖存储性能将得到进一步的提升和优化

    同时,用户也应持续关注新技术的发展动态,及时将新技术应用于实际环境中,以不断提升系统的整体性能和用户体验

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道